perf-unocss.config.js 配置,适配小程序

This commit is contained in:
Huang 2022-11-29 14:11:19 +08:00
parent 64e858bce1
commit 9d3962e816

View File

@ -4,7 +4,7 @@
* @link unocss-preset-weapp: https://github.com/MellowCo/unocss-preset-weapp
* */
import { defineConfig, presetAttributify, presetIcons } from 'unocss';
import { defineConfig, presetIcons } from 'unocss';
import presetWeapp from 'unocss-preset-weapp';
import {
transformerAttributify,
@ -37,6 +37,7 @@ export default defineConfig({
whRpx: true,
transform: true,
platform: 'uniapp',
transformRules,
}),
presetIcons({
scale: 1.2,
@ -51,13 +52,11 @@ export default defineConfig({
],
theme: {},
transformers: [
// options 见 https://github.com/MellowCo/unocss-preset-weapp/tree/main/src/transformer/transformerAttributify
transformerAttributify({
classPrefix: prefix,
transformRules,
nonValuedAttribute: true,
}),
// options 见 https://github.com/MellowCo/unocss-preset-weapp/tree/main/src/transformer/transformerClass
transformerClass({
transformRules,
}),